How does it work, is it any good and recommendations would be welcome, would like to store digital photos safely just incase laptop dies.

MaureenMLove · 21/05/2012 22:13

I've got mine on Pisaca. It seems to work for me. The only reason I chose that one, was because my laptop came with the software on it! I'm not very geeky, so I don't know if you need to download stuff first, but once you have worked that out, it's really easy.

I can simply upload pictures to my laptop from device and they are automatially saved in my hard drive Pisaca file. When I open it, there's a button which says, 'upload to internet' and it does it within a few seconds.

You can also move them back to your laptop with a click of a button. There's face recognision on it too. It automatically takes snap shots of faces to new pictures, so you don't need to crop if you wanted a close up for example. Good for doing collages and you can e-mail single picutres to people or sent an e-mail link to one particular album.

baabaapinksheep · 21/05/2012 22:18

Dropbox. You download it to your computer, and it is just like another folder. You can add or delete things as easily as any other folder, but it is online so can be accessed from anywhere. You can also add people so they can view what's in the folder.
